🍋 Lemon Basil Chicken with Roasted Summer Veggies
⏱ Quick Stats
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 25 minutes
Total Time: 35 minutes
Serves: 4
🛒 Ingredients
Lemon Basil Chicken
1½ lbs chicken breast or thighs
2 tbsp olive oil
Zest + juice of 1 large lemon
3 cloves garlic, minced
½ cup fresh basil, chopped
¾ tsp sea salt
¼ tsp black pepper (optional)
Roasted Veggies
2 cups broccoli florets
1 zucchini, sliced
1 yellow squash, sliced
1 bell pepper, sliced
1 cup cherry tomatoes
1 tbsp olive oil
Pinch of salt
Optional Add-Ons
Jasmine rice
Quinoa
Cauliflower rice
Mixed greens
Optional Finish
Extra fresh basil
Lemon wedges
Red pepper flakes
👩🍳 Easy Step-by-Step Instructions
Step 1: Marinate the Chicken
In a bowl, combine:
olive oil, lemon zest + juice, garlic, basil, salt, and pepper.
Add chicken and let sit for 10–20 minutes (or longer if you have time).
Step 2: Roast the Veggies
Preheat oven to 425°F.
Toss veggies with olive oil + salt and spread onto a sheet pan.
Roast for 20–25 minutes until tender and slightly caramelized.
Step 3: Cook the Chicken
While veggies roast, cook chicken in a skillet over medium heat
5–6 minutes per side until cooked through.
Let rest, then slice.
Step 4: Build Your Plate
Serve chicken alongside roasted veggies or over your base of choice.
Step 5: Finish Strong
Top with:
🌿 fresh basil
🍋 extra lemon squeeze
🌶 optional heat
🔥 Meal Prep Tips
This one is super easy to carry through the week:
✅ Cook chicken ahead
✅ Roast a big batch of veggies
✅ Store separately for freshness
Mix and match for quick meals all week.
